As Hari Raya Aidilfitri approaches, shopping centres across the country transform into vibrant festive spaces — and this year, 1 Utama Shopping Centre is bringing a charming kampung-inspired celebration with Indahnya Syawal, happening from 27 February to 29 March 2026.

    

A Kampung Raya Experience in the City

Visitors stepping into the mall will find themselves transported into Kampung Indah Syawal, a beautifully designed festive installation located at LG Oval and GF Centre Court. The highlight is a stunning two-storey traditional Malay home, thoughtfully adorned with the intricate textures of songket, one of the most treasured fabrics in Malay heritage.

The display blends traditional craftsmanship with contemporary design, creating a warm and nostalgic kampung setting right in the middle of the city. It’s the perfect spot to stroll through, admire the details of traditional art, and of course, capture some memorable Raya photos.

At the centre of it all stands the Pentas Tanjak Warisan, an eye-catching stage inspired by the elegant tanjak, the traditional Malay headgear often associated with royalty and heritage. Positioned at the LG Oval Concourse, this cultural centrepiece becomes the heart of the celebration, hosting performances and festive activities throughout the campaign.

Discover Arts, Crafts & Cultural Workshops

Beyond the decorations, visitors can immerse themselves in Malaysian heritage through a variety of arts and craft experiences. The Arts & Craft Market by Kraftangan Malaysia takes place every weekend from 27 February to 19 March, showcasing handmade crafts and traditional artisanal products.

Those looking for a more hands-on experience can participate in the Bengkel Kreativiti Seni workshops held daily. Activities include crafting Wayang Kulit puppets, batik and labu painting, mosaic coaster making, and mini rattan art. Visitors can also witness demonstrations of songket weaving and learn the traditional art of tanjak-making, offering a deeper appreciation for the craftsmanship behind Malay cultural heritage.
